About this extension
Breader extension makes it easy to save web pages to your Breader account for reading later.

Features:
- Right-click anywhere on a page and select "Save to Breader"
- Use keyboard shortcut (Ctrl+Period or Cmd+Period on Mac)
- Opens a quick-add form where you can customize title, add tags, and set reading status
- Works seamlessly with breader.app

Privacy: This extension does not collect any user data. All bookmarks are saved to your personal Breader account.
